Heads up, plugin folks: the Quillhaven inventory reconciliation job now runs hourly instead of nightly, so your hooks get called more often but with smaller diffs. If your plugin does heavy writes, batch them. We sized the defaults for mid-tier stores on the Fernbrook cluster. Here are the tuning constants we settled on.

tuning constants:
QUOTAS = {
    "druwyn": 5,
    "holix": 5,
    "zorath": 5,
    "holwyn": 10,
}

Subject: Key rotation — FuelTrace report

Hey all,

Quick heads up: we rotated the credentials the FuelTrace fleet fuel-usage report uses to hit the internal TankSum aggregator. The old key stops working Friday, so if your review branch runs the report end-to-end, swap it out before then. Everything else (endpoints, scopes) is unchanged, so it should be a one-line diff. The new staging key is below.

service key, tadup-tahog: zpat7_wB1tnEL

# Env file — Cartwheel dispatch, driver-assignment heuristic
# Scope: staging only. Do not promote to prod.
# The heuristic weights (proximity, shift balance, refusal rate) are tuned
# for the Velmont pilot region and will misbehave elsewhere.
# Review notes: heuristic service runs unprivileged; it reads weights
# read-only from the tuning store and writes nothing back.
# Only one sensitive value exists in this file: the tuning-store access
# credential, consumed at boot and never logged.
# That credential is set on the following line.

secret setting of faduf-bahop: LEDGER_TOKEN8=c3b363be

Vendor note: KeyMill, our internal secrets-rotation utility, replaces the third-party rotation contract expiring next quarter. No renewal needed. KeyMill handles database creds and API tokens; certificates stay with the existing pipeline for now. Migration of remaining services is tracked in the platform backlog. Flag blockers at this week's sync. Questions on scope or timelines go to the KeyMill owners.

escalation mailbox, bafog-fafog: ulador@paliqlabs.internal

MEMO — Kettling Depot Receiving

Uniform sets for the new Kettling depot arrive Wednesday via Ashgrove courier: 40 boxes, sorted by size, manifest attached to box one. Check the count at the dock before signing; shortages go straight to stores, not the courier. The hand-over instruction the courier will follow is set out below.

drop instructions, tafof-baguf: the holmir gilox courier leaves the sormir ulaok holdor ledger at gate 5596 under passcode 257343